Use to verify or create a Queue on a Salesforce org for a routable sObject (Case | Incident | MessagingSession | VoiceCall), discovered via its QueueSobject binding rather than by hardcoded name. Reuses whatever queue already routes the target sObject; with --create-if-missing it creates a Queue via the Metadata API (Group + QueueSobject) when none is bound and aligns its QueueRoutingConfigId to a caller-specified QRC. Returns created, reused, updated, or blocked. Triggers: verify or create a queue for Case/Incident/Messaging/Voice routing, align queue routing config, set up an Omni voice queue. Do not use to add users to the queue (service-omni-queue-members-assign) or for sObjects outside Case/Incident/MessagingSession/VoiceCall.
Use to bind agent users into a Salesforce Queue via GroupMember Data API POSTs, with SOQL-based idempotency (safe re-run — only inserts missing bindings). Binds either the generated demo agents (agent{1..N}.<suffix>@example.com) or an explicit list of real agents passed as usernames/User Ids. Triggers: add agents to a Case/Voice queue, assign agent users to a queue, populate queue membership for Omni routing. Do not use to create the queue (service-omni-queue-deploy), to create the agent users (service-omni-agent-users-create), or to assign permission sets (service-omni-permission-set-assign).
